Mitie is seeking a Cleaner in Fenton, England. The role involves maintaining cleanliness in designated areas while ensuring compliance with Health and Safety requirements.
The ideal candidate should be reliable, possess basic English communication skills, and have a flexible approach.
Benefits include:
- Holiday entitlement
- Pension contributions
- Discounts with retailers
This part-time, permanent position offers 20 hours of work per week at a rate of £12.71 per hour.

How to prepare for a job interview at Mitie
✨Know Your Role
Make sure you understand the responsibilities of a Cleaner at a health centre. Familiarise yourself with Health and Safety requirements, as this will show that you take the role seriously and are ready to comply with necessary regulations.
✨Show Your Reliability
Reliability is key for this position. Be prepared to discuss your previous work experience and provide examples of how you've demonstrated dependability in past roles. This could be arriving on time, completing tasks efficiently, or being flexible when needed.
✨Brush Up on Basic English
Since basic English communication skills are required, practice speaking clearly and confidently. You might be asked about your previous experience or how you would handle certain situations, so being able to express yourself well will make a great impression.
✨Highlight Your Flexibility
This role requires a flexible approach, so think of examples where you've adapted to changing circumstances. Whether it’s adjusting your schedule or taking on additional tasks, showing that you can be flexible will set you apart from other candidates.
